    Why is there no shielding gas in my Fronius TRANS STEEL 3500 C0MPACT Welding System?
    • C
      Courtney BernardAug 17, 2025
      If your Fronius Welding System isn't providing shielding gas, start by changing the gas cylinder if it's empty. If the cylinder isn't the issue, then replace the gas pressure regulator if it's faulty. Check the gas hose; fit or replace it if it's damaged or not fitted properly. If the issue persists, the welding torch may be faulty and require replacement. If all else fails, the gas solenoid valve might be faulty, in that case contact After-Sales Service.

    What does 'Err | PE' mean on my Fronius TRANS STEEL 3500 C0MPACT Welding System and how can I fix it?
    • S
      Susan SalinasAug 20, 2025
      If your Fronius Welding System displays 'Err | PE', switch off the power source. Place the power source on an insulating surface. Connect the grounding cable to a section of the workpiece closer to the arc. Wait 10 seconds, then switch the power source back on.

    What to do if there is no welding current in my Fronius TRANS STEEL 3500 C0MPACT Welding System?
    • J
      jasongrahamAug 26, 2025
      If your Fronius Welding System shows 'No welding current', consider the following: 1. Take the duty cycle into account to avoid overload. 2. Wait for the power source to automatically restart after the cooling phase if the thermostatic safety cut-out has tripped. 3. Ensure adequate cooling air by cleaning the air filter and ensuring accessible cooling air ducts. 4. If the fan is faulty, contact After-Sales Service.

    How to improve poor weld properties in my Fronius TRANS STEEL 3500 C0MPACT?
    • K
      Katie RodriguezAug 31, 2025
      If your Fronius Welding System isn't welding properly, check the welding parameter settings and ensure they are correct. Ensure good contact to the workpiece for proper grounding. Inspect the pressure regulator, gas hose, gas solenoid valve, and torch gas connection to ensure there is an adequate protective gas shield. Replace the welding torch if it's leaking. Replace the contact tube if it is wrong or worn out. Check the wire spool to ensure the correct wire alloy and diameter are being used, and check the weldability of the base material. Use the correct protective gas shield for the wire alloy.

    Why is the wire feed speed irregular in my Fronius TRANS STEEL 3500 C0MPACT?
    • W
      Wanda ColeSep 12, 2025
      If your Fronius Welding System has an irregular wire feed speed, try the following: 1. Loosen the brake if the braking force is set too high. 2. Use a suitable contact tube if the hole in the current contact tube is too narrow. 3. Check the wire feed liner for kinks or dirt. 4. Use suitable feed rollers for the wire electrode being used. 5. Optimize the contact pressure of the feed rollers.
